Sam and Emma host Harvey Kaye, professor emeritus of democracy at the University of Wisconsin, Green Bay, and Alan Minsky, executive director of the Progressive Democrats of America, to discuss their recent mission statement published in Common Dreams, the 21st Century Economic Bill of Rights. However, Emma and Sam first dive into yesterday’s mass shooting at an elementary school in Texas, walking through the mass boom in gun sales over the past two years, the common link between mass shooters and violence against women, and the ahistorical neoliberal view that gun control is a revolutionary concept in the US. Then, they’re joined by Professor Harvey Kaye and executive director Alan Minsky as they dive into the history of economic bills of rights, first proposed in the US by FDR as a centerpiece to his 1944 State of the Union, built on his economic declaration of rights and his concept of the four freedoms (speech, worship, freedom from want, freedom from fear), and looking to support the rights people wanted to see enumerated after World War II, seeing healthcare and jobs, particularly, as central to defeating the constraints of need. These concepts were then picked up by the democratic party under Truman, and even framed as the party platform in 1960 ahead of JFK’s candidacy. Next, Kaye and Minsky walk through the 10 rights present in the 21st Century Declaration, including universal healthcare, the right to education and the internet, affordable and accessible housing, a clean environment, support at birth and in retirement, a fair justice system, sound financial services, and a right to recreation and participation in democratic life, all of which, as they walk through, are tied to current legislation supported by Bernie Sanders, the squad, and other progressives. Next, they dive into the rhetorical element of this fight, perhaps the one in which we have the longest to go, first looking at the relationship between liberty and governing powers, before diving into what a productive future for a progressive left in the US would look like, both in terms of changing the conversation and building on the CPC’s existing role in the Democratic Party.

Sam and Emma host Blake Emerson, assistant professor at the UCLA School of Law, to discuss some of the recent rulings coming out of the 5th Circuit. Then, Sam and Emma are joined by Leah Litman, assistant professor at Michigan Law School and contributor to Slate, to discuss the recent SCOTUS ruling for Sen. Ted Cruz against the SEC. Emma and Sam start the show by diving into the US finally accepting trade with Venezuela, unsurprisingly centered on oil, the AP’s acceptance that it was, despite everything Israel was saying, probably the IDF that murdered Shereen Abu Aqleh, Kushner and Mnunchin’s ties to middle eastern oligarchs, and David Purdue doubling down on racism to win his primary and go up against Stacy Abrams. Then, Professor Emerson joins as they break down the recent ambush on the SEC in the Fifth Circuit, discussing WHAT this Texas-based circuit is, the appellate court’s role, and why Jarkesy v SEC was chosen to break down regulatory and administrative capacities of the executive branch. Next, they look at what the case entailed, parsing why the SEC chose to prosecute George Jarkesy in an administrative court, and why, like other agencies from the FDA to the EPA, this ability allowed them to expressly enforce policy without relying on years-long court cases or having to sacrifice their expertise. Professor Emerson then dives into the actual decision, walking through the court’s claims that it: 1) Violated the right to a jury; 2) violated the THEORETICAL non-delegation principle; and 3) violated the unitary executive theory, which, as a theory, is ALSO theoretical, and discusses how all three are incredibly outlandish decisions, particularly for a court that should be committed to Supreme Court precedent. Then Leah Litman hops in as she, Emma, and Sam look at the crumbling judicial infrastructure of constitutional rights in the US, from the Voting Rights Act to Roe v. Wade, and parses through Ted Cruz’s own case brought against the SEC under the right to use post-election contributions to repay pre-election loans, and the state’s commitment to poorly representing its constituents in Shinn v Martinez/Ramirez.

Sam and Emma host David Dayen, executive editor at the American Prospect, to discuss his recent piece in the Intercept "BLOWING THE TRUCK WHISTLE: A Carbon Dioxide Delivery Driver’s Long Journey to Expose Airgas", on one of many examples of the US’ failing infrastructure. Sam and Emma begin by previewing tomorrow’s primaries in Texas and Georgia, also touching on the news of Ginni Thomas’ encouragement of overturning the 2020 election, US aid to Israel largely contributing to the destruction of US aid to Gaza and Palestine, and the chaos of NYS redistricting. Then, David joins as they first walk through the recent baby formula crisis in the US as the first example of our failing infrastructure, diving into the recalled production from Abbott labs – which produces approximately 20% of all formula in the US – and assessing what makes baby formula production different than other supply lines, with 98% of it actually coming from domestic production. Next, they discuss the similar problems we’ve faced since the start of the COVID-19 pandemic, from PPE at the start of 2020 to the semiconductors that stunted countless industries of production when Taiwan shut down, and look at the elements of the US and neoliberal economies that set the stage for these failures, from centralization and emphasis on efficiency to a lack of resiliency or redundancy for any future crisis. Next, they walk through the state-by-state monopolies which guide the production of baby formula in the US, of which Abbott holds 34 states and DC, and how the US’ thoughtlessly structured welfare programs set the system up to fail. They wrap up the interview by covering David’s new piece and what we can learn from the failure of the trucking and shipping industries to self-regulate, and why, as always, the repercussions were shifted to fall on the wage laborers.

Sam and Emma host Jon Marshall, associate professor at the Medill School of Journalism at Northwestern University, to discuss his recent book Clash: Presidents and the Press in Times of Crisis. Then, Sam and Emma are joined by Alex Speidel, organizer for the United Paizo Workers to discuss their meeting at the White House and Paizo's unionizing efforts. Professor Marshall dives right into where the dynamic between the Presidency and the press stands today, looking at the troubled relationship as a continuation of two centuries of US history. Next, he, Emma, and Sam jump back to the 1790s, looking to John Adams’ attacks on newspapers via the Sedition Act, cracking down on critiques of the government, only to see a spectacular backfire with a resounding loss in the election of 1800. Prof Marshal then walks through the structure he follows in his analysis, using ten specific presidencies that he thought reflected the progression of this dynamic, next moving forwards to the Presidency of Abe Lincoln, and the influence he took from the abolitionist press of the time, seeing it both as a central perspective to take in on the issue and as an important part of his GOP coalition, as the press pushed him from a tentative but anti-slavery president to signing the emancipation proclamation. Emma, Sam, and Jon then move forwards to Woodrow Wilson’s prosecution of anti-war journalists during the first World War, not only relying on Adams’ Sedition Act but bringing about the Trading with Enemies and Espionage acts, and the rollback of the overwhelming executive isolation from the press as the war ended – particularly after his lack of a relationship with the press saw the Right step in and turn public opinion on his League of Nations – before the Espionage act made its return in the late aughts and early 2010s with Obama employing the act against whistleblowers more than all previous presidents combined. This, of course, set the stage for Donald Trump’s presidency, and his extension of espionage to journalists on the *receiving* end of leaks, particularly amidst the media boom of the 21st century, with countless new avenues (both more and less legitimate) arising between the President and media, yet algorithms and a crippling of local news serving to corrupt and corporatize much of the industry. They wrap up the interview by diving deeper into disinformation in media and the role government can, and should, play in supporting integrity in journalism. Then, Alex Speidel joins as they discuss what Paizo is, the size of the TTRPG industry, and how the pandemic saw space for him and his co-workers to create personal bonds that would serve as the eventual web of solidarity for the first North American TTRPG union and beyond. Sam and Emma host Tony Delorio, Secretary-Treasurer of the Teamsters Local 665, to discuss the recent organizing efforts at Amy's Kitchen in Los Angeles. Then Sam and Emma are joined by India Walton, former mayoral candidate in Buffalo and Senior Strategic Organizer at Roots Action, to discuss the push to cancel student debt in the U.S. Tony, Sam, and Emma dive right into the Teamsters Local 665’s work with food processing workers at Amy’s Kitchen, famed frozen food provider, after responding to calls from workers and being met with some of the harshest working conditions that they’d seen, with a near 50% rise in production with no additional workers, and “benefits” that were frankly driving workers deeper in debt. Central to this, as Tony explores, was the relationship to medical benefits, as the factory had a working relationship with a nearby medical center that sent workers right back to work before, in the wake of the first unionization attempts, Amy’s granted workers a generous $2/hr wage, only for medical premiums to go up by $400, thus the “raise” meant workers were losing up to $80 per month. Next, Tony, Emma, and Sam dive into how this abuse came to be from a company that espouses an organic, community-based, family working culture, telling a story that is all too similar with a slow-but-steady development of Amy’s Kitchen into a large-scale corporation, with the founding family stepping to the side in favor of the executive board, and looking away as working conditions dwindled. Tony then gets into the work between the Teamsters and workers, as the initial unionization attempts were quickly followed by a realization that what was really needed was a large-scale media push, which came alongside a worker-supported boycott by coops across the US, filing B Corp complaints, and drawing attention to the union-busting attempts going on. They wrap up the interview by looking deeper into the state of labor in the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ic, with Biden’s NLRB actually stepping up for workers as massive corporations like Starbucks and Amazon crackdown on dissident workers. Then, Sam and Emma are joined by India Walton as they cover her perspective on the Biden Administration’s internal student debt relief, from quantity to means testing, and why she holds hope for a full 50k in relief, before diving deeper into how the student debt crisis came to be, how it impacts everyday folks, and why this policy would be a massive win for Democrats.

Sam and Emma host Lily Geismer, professor of history at Claremont McKenna College, to discuss her recent book Left Behind: The Democrats' Failed Attempt to Solve Inequality. on the shift from New Deal democratic ideology, to the neoliberal tactic of entrusting social development in private enterprise in a pivot to the white suburbanite. Professor Geismer first discusses the ascendancy of this Democratic ideology, situating us in the late 80s with the rise of the MIke Dukakises, Tony Coelhoes, and Bill Clintons, embracing tech, trade, and finance as the solution to economic growth, from the Route 128 in Mass to Coelho’s focus on raising corporate money, and the inspiration Governor Clinton (during his Arkansas years) took from these policies. Next, she, Emma, and Sam walk through how this sector of the Democratic party came to be, as in the wake of the 1960s the Democrats found themselves on the defensive, with all of their policy coming as a reaction to the shifting GOP, and a new guard of “Watergate Babies” coming in and opposition traditional Democrats and fueling mistrust of government, asking for a shift away from the special interest groups of the labor movement and focusing on middle-class white suburbanites. Next, Professor Geismer looks to the shift that these Democrats took from focusing on “fairness” to promoting “opportunity” in a major move away from redistributive politics and towards promoting (supposedly) meritocratic capitalism, and dives deeper into what Bill Clinton’s Arkansas looked like, from his attempted emulation of Silicon Valley to bringing in ShoreBank and other early microeconomic financiers, cutting social security in preference for privatized loans to certain poor folks. Looking to the Democratic primaries of the 1980s, they then dive into why this emerging neoliberal wing was able to win over the future of the Democratic party, coming to climax with Bill Clinton’s market-driven pseudo-populism, and leading to three decades demonstrating exactly why this ideology cannot function. After briefly touching on the differences between the “Watergate Baby” form of neoliberalism and Milton Friedman’s form of neoliberalism, Emma, Sam, and Prof. Geismer wrap up with a discussion on whether or not we are seeing the end of this era, and what the world we are moving towards might look like. Emma hosts Kim Kelly, labor reporter and columnist at Teen Vogue, to discuss her recent book Fight Like Hell: The Untold History of American Labor. Then Emma is joined by Jessica Cisneros, candidate for Congress in Texas's 28th Congressional District, to give us an update from the campaign trail. Kim Kelly begins by just situating the current state of the labor movement, particularly coming off of her reporting from Bessemer, Alabama, and reflecting on the differences between that Amazon unionization effort and the success we’ve seen in Staten Island recently, before she and Emma get into the importance of looking to labor history for lessons from past organizers and past victories. Next, they get into the mythological image of the American union worker, the older white guy with grease on him, and the electoral fetishization of appealing to him, contrasting this figure with the incredibly diverse makeup of a working class. Kelly then looks to her own connection to organizing, first reflecting on her parent’s union membership and then getting into her first experience unionizing the Vice office back in the early 2010s, becoming only the second digital media union, and seeing firsthand how unions can achieve incredible things for their workers, from accessible and gender-affirming care to reasonable wages and myriad other material changes. She and Emma then jump back to 1824 discussing the first factory strike in US history, by young women in Pawtucket, Rhode Island, as a first example of how unionization is both not a white male activity, and is incredibly effective at lifting those who are viewed as easily exploitable into positions of leverage and safety, looking to more contemporary examples of Flight Attendants as well, before looking to how executives use different racial and cultural groups to divide workers. Moving to the turn of the century, they first discuss the mass strikes of washerwomen in Atlanta during the 1881 Cotton Exposition as they get into a discussion on the segregation of the labor movement, looking also to the brotherhood of sleeping car porters (the first AFL-recognized Black union), and the Philly local aid chapter of the IWW (the first nationally recognized interracial union), before they shift slightly to the large-scale women’s organizing movement like the uprising of the 20,000 in NYC, discussing the paths they inspired including the impact of the Triangle Shirtwaist Factory pushing one of the biggest engineers, Frances Perkins, of social security and the New Deal deeper into the realm of organizing. Moving to the West Coast, Kim and Emma discuss how the 1940s saw sugar cane plantations in Hawaii continuously shift between targeted immigrant communities, dropping one and looking to another as each organized themselves (before working together), and dive into the “Ya Basta!” movement for janitors in CA, before wrapping up by touching on the current state of the NLRB and the inspiration we can find in (certain places of) the Biden Administration. Emma also chats with Jessica Cisneros on fighting for workers and a progressive agenda when up against an anti-choice Democrat in Texas.

Sam and Emma host J. David McSwane, reporter at ProPublica, to discuss his recent book Pandemic Inc.: Chasing the Capitalists and Thieves Who Got Rich While We Got Sick, on the fraudulent paths of government money at the height of the COVID-19 pandemic. David begins by covering the state of our infrastructure (or lack thereof) at the start of the pandemic, including an incredible 1% of necessary strategic reserves of PPE and other equipment which had been cut down in the wake of Democrats’ sequestration attempts in the 2010s and Donald Trump’s general crippling of anything governmental. Moving into the actual governmental response, David, Emma, and Sam then dive into how the execution of early pandemic policy genuinely made the preparations look effective, as nearly half of the pandemic response budget was swallowed up by corporations who held largely expired goods, setting a government contracting frenzy shoveling cash to any dude on the streets who said they had access to masks. Exploring this, David walks through his experiences on Robert Stewart’s private jets, jumping across the country clearly in search of more excuses for the never-to-materialize masks, before getting into the story of Mike Bowen’s Prestige Ameritech, perhaps the only legitimate source of masks that the US Government explored, and how his deal fell through due to personality differences, and touching on how one Fillakit LLC acquired their contract and shipped pre-expanded soda bottles through FEMA and across the country. Next, David McSwane dives into the role of the Kushner children in expanding this fraud beyond government contracts to the Paycheck Protection Program, diving into the myriad pseudo corporations and fake farms that sprang up to claim millions.
